Dr Paul Cunningham and Nic Saunders: Keeping Pets Safe in the Heat

As summer approaches, heat stroke, flat-faced breeds, and even a brief car trip can pose deadly risks to pets. Paul and Nic from ‘Ready Vet Go’ share what owners need to look out for, why bulldogs and pugs are especially vulnerable, and when to call an ambulance instead of driving to the vet yourself.
